Kashgar, the historic meeting point of the North and South Silk Roads, has been a crossroads of cultures and trade for centuries. From here, ancient caravans split towards Kyrgyzstan, Pakistan, and beyond, eventually reaching as far as Rome. This tour begins in Kyrgyzstan, entering China via the Torugart Pass near Naryn. After two days exploring the Kashgar region, the journey concludes by exiting to Kyrgyzstan via the Irkeshtam Pass near Osh.

Day 2: Kashgar to Karakul Lake – 200km (5 hours)
Highlights: The Karakoram Highway (KKH), Opal Village, Oytagh Valley, White Sand Mountain, Karakul Lake
Depart from Kashgar and travel southwest along the Karakoram Highway (KKH), following the ancient Silk Road route to Pakistan. Stop at Opal Village to purchase food for a picnic at Karakul Lake。 Visit Oytagh Valley and White Sand Mountain for stunning photo opportunities. Arrive at Karakul Lake, situated at an elevation of 3,600m and surrounded by the snow-capped peaks of Muztagh Ata (7,546m) and Kongur (7,719m). Enjoy free time to walk around the lake, ride horses, and soak in the breathtaking scenery. Return to Kashgar in the evening. Overnight: Kashgar

Day 3: Kashgar City Tour
Highlights: Apak Hoja Tomb, Kashgar Livestock Market, Sunday Bazaar, Kashgar Old Town, Id Kah Mosque, Handicrafts Street
Begin the day at the Apak Hoja Tomb, built in 1640. This chamber tomb houses 72 members of the Hoja family across five generations. Drive 15km west to the Kashgar Livestock Market, where ancient trading traditions come alive. After lunch, explore the Sunday Bazaar, the largest traditional market in China, offering everything from spices to handicrafts. Stroll through Kashgar Old Town, where locals live in beautifully preserved traditional homes. Visit the Id Kah Mosque, the largest mosque in China, built in 1442. This iconic Arabic-style mosque can accommodate up to 30,000 worshippers at once. Explore Handicrafts Street, a vibrant area filled with handmade goods, from exotic musical instruments to traditional kitchenware. Return to the hotel after dinner. Overnight: Kashgar
